首先,网约车App的用户需求是开发的核心。用户需要方便、快捷的叫车服务,在能够快速找到空闲车辆的同时,也需要知道预计到达时间、费用以及车辆位置等信息。为了满足这些需求,网约车App需要具备以下功能:
1. 实时定位功能:用户可以通过App获取当前位置,并根据定位信息查找周围的空闲车辆。
2. 预约叫车功能:用户可以选择提前预约出行时间,系统会根据用户需求提前为用户分配车辆。
3. 电子支付功能:用户可以通过App直接支付车费,无需使用现金。支付功能要安全可靠,并提供多种支付方式,如支付宝、微信支付等。
4. 路线规划功能:用户可以输入目的地信息,系统会为其规划最佳行车路线,提供导航服务。
5. 司机评价功能:用户完成一次行程后,可以对司机进行评价,提供反馈意见。
其次,网约车App的技术方案需要考虑可扩展性和稳定性。为了满足大量用户同时使用的需求,需要采用分布式架构,通过负载均衡技术实现高可用性。同时,还需要采用高性能的数据库和缓存技术,提高数据访问速度。App的界面设计应简洁明了,操作流畅,尽量减少用户等待时间。
此外,网约车App的安全性也是至关重要的。用户个人隐私信息需要进行加密处理,确保数据不会被泄露。支付功能需要采用安全的加密协议,保证用户的资金安全。对于司机信息的审核也是必不可少的,在司机注册时需要进行身份验证和驾照认证,以确保乘客的安全。
最后,考虑到市场竞争的激烈程度,开发一款成功的网约车App还需要进行市场调研和精细化推广。通过了解竞争对手的产品特点和用户反馈,可以找到差异化的创新点。在推广方面,可以通过广告投放、口碑传播以及与其他企业的深度合作等方式来吸引用户关注和使用。
综上所述,网约车App的开发方案需要从用户需求、技术方案和安全性等多个方面进行综合考虑。只有在考虑周全的基础上,才能开发出满足市场需求的优质产品。同时,还应关注产品的不断创新和市场推广,以在竞争激烈的市场中取得成功。